KNOW YOUR PRESSURE WASHER

Read this owner’s manual and safety rules before operating your pressure washer.
Compare the illustrations with your pressure washer to familiarize yourself with the locations of various controls and
adjustments. Save this manual for future reference.

Air Cleaner — Dry type filter element limits the amount
of dirt and dust that gets in the engine.

Automatic Cool Down System — Cycles water
through pump when water reaches 125°-155°F. Warm
water will discharge from pump onto ground.This
system prevents internal pump damage.

Chemical Injection Siphon/Filter — Use to siphon
detergent or other pressure washer chemicals into the low
pressure stream.

Fuel Tank — Fill tank with regular unleaded fuel.

High Pressure Hose — Connect one end to water
pump and the other end to spray gun.

High Pressure Outlet — Connection for high pressure
hose.

Data Tag (not shown, near rear of base plate)
Provides model and serial number of pressure washer.
Please have these readily available if calling for assistance.

Primer Bulb — Prepares a cold engine for starting.

Pump — Develops high water pressure.

Recoil Starter — Used for starting the engine manually.

Spray Gun — Controls the application of water onto
cleaning surface with trigger device. Includes safety latch.

Water Inlet — Connection for garden hose.
